TALOS is a higher overall performance humanoid biped robot standing at 1.75m. PAL Robotics’ walking biped robot can lift up to six Kg with one stretched arm, is fully electrical and one hundred% ROS primarily based. Honda additional than two decades ago unveiled Asimo, which resembled a life-size space suit and was shown in a meticulously-orchestrated demonstration to be in a position to pour liquid into a cup.

In 2013, ATLAS, dubbed by its designers as “the world’s most dynamic humanoid,” was introduced. Boston Dynamics created and produced it with assistance from the US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ency, especially for use in search and rescue operations . It can find its way over hard terrain and about obstacles in its route with the use of sensors like variety sensing, stereo vision, and other technologies.
